Briana is excited because she has just been hired by a family to babysit on Saturdays. She’s looking forward to earning some ext

ra spending money! The family will pay her $12 per hour for a maximum of 8 hours. Brianna makes a table to show her earnings for different numbers of hours. Help her complete the table.

List the hours from 1 to 8

Multiply the hours by how much she is paid per hour ( $12)

X: 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8

y: 12, 24, 36, 48, 60, 72, 84, 96

We know that a summation formula for the first n natural numbers:

1+2+3+...+(n-2)+(n-1)+n=\frac{n(n+1)}{2}

We use the formula, we get

a) 1+2+3+4+...+396+397+398+399=\frac{399·(399+1)}{2}=\frac{399· 400}{2}=399· 200=79800

b) 1+2+3+4+...+546+547+548+549=\frac{549·(549+1)}{2}=\frac{549· 550}{2}=549· 275=150975

c)2+4+6+8+...+72+74+76+78=S / ( :2)

1+2+3+4+...+36+37+38+39=S/2

\frac{39·(39+1)}{2}=S/2

\frac{39·40}{2}=S/2

39·40=S

1560=S

Therefore, we get

2+4+6+8+...+72+74+76+78=1560

How many subsets are there in (a,b,c,d,e,f,h,i)?​
Bond [772]

Answer:

The set has 256 subsets

Step-by-step explanation:

The set is [a,b,c,d,e,f,h,i]

Number of subset can be calculated from the formula

{2}^{n}

where n is the number of element in the set

n=8

This implies that

{2}^{n} =   {2}^{8} =256
